As mentioned previously in this article, it is perhaps much easier to ‘get away with’ the use of Testosterone at supraphysiological (bodybuilding) doses rather than the use of certain other compounds, merely due to the fact that the metabolites are very similar to those secreted by the body endogenously. This is the reason as to why many athletes have circumvented testing procedures and have successfully doped without being caught (or have gone a very long time doping before being caught). For example Deca-Durabolin (Nandrolone Decanoate) is easily detectible via the detection of its metabolite 19-norandrosterone in the urine. Dianabol metabolites are excreted primarily through the urine, and specialized tests — such as gas chromatography-mass spectrometry (GC-MS) — can detect them weeks after the last dose. Detection time refers to how long metabolites of the drug remain in your system candy96.fun in quantities that can be detected by modern testing protocols. Chemically, Dianabol is a C17-alpha alkylated derivative of testosterone, designed to survive first-pass liver metabolism so it can be taken orally. The detection window in blood is shorter, typically ranging from a few hours to a few days. In general, Dianabol can be detected in urine for up to 5-6 weeks after the last dose.
